May 2025 - Apr 2026Maidstone Road area has the 17th highest crime rate of 74 local areas in Lakenham , and the 29th highest crime rate of 442 local areas in Norwich .
Neighbouring streets tend to have noticeably higher crime levels than this postcode. Crime here is lower than the average for the surrounding output areas.
The overall crime rate in the area around Maidstone Road (NR1 1EA) in the last 12 months was 341.8 per 1,000 residents and was 231.8% higher than the Lakenham average (103.0 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 50 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Criminal damage and arson 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Bicycle theft 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 60 (≈ 218.2 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-46.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Maidstone Road (NR1 1EA), the main crime hotspot is near Nightclub. Police recorded 354 crimes here, including 234 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
